What is Unmixr Text to Speech Studio?
expand_moreUnmixr AI Text to Speech Studio is a tool that turns text into realistic, human-like voiceovers with customization options like pitch, speed, emotion, and accents.
-
How does credit work in text-to-speech?
expand_moreCredits are calculated based on the number of characters in your script. Each plan includes a monthly or lifetime credit balance depending on your plan. Standard Voices (Prebuilt, Multilingual, Cloned, etc.): 1 credit = 1 character Persona Voices: 2 credits = 1 character. Why the difference? Some voices require more advanced AI and computing resources. That's why they consume more credits per character.

Can I customize word pronunciation?
expand_moreYes, customize pronunciation by selecting text or saving words in the global pronunciation library, which applies automatically.
-
How do I add pauses in my voiceover?
expand_moreAdd pauses by selecting text and choosing the pause option, or by typing [pause 8s] for an 8-second pause.

What audio formats can I download?
expand_moreUnmixr offers several formats for download, including MP3, WAV, FLAC, OGG and AIFF. You can customize codec, bitrate, channel, volume and quality in the advanced settings. To download audio in any of these fomats choose Audio Converter, select audio then choose settings and Submit.
-
How do I merge multiple audio clips?
expand_moreSelect and merge multiple audio clips to create seamless, continuous audio. To merge audios, go to My Audios then select two or more audios. Now click on Merge Audios, give a title and Submit. Optionally you can add silence in each audio or add more audios from the dropdown.

How do I import a script into Unmixr?
expand_moreCopy and paste your script into the text box in the editor, where you can further customize it or click on the Import wizard right above the voice editor. You can import PDF, Word, ePUB, Text files and any public webpage.
